Understanding the Narrative



“The Last Great American Dynasty” tells the story of Rebekah Harkness, a socialite and philanthropist who was married to oil heir Bill Harkness. Swift narrates Harkness’s life, drawing parallels between her own experiences and the tumultuous existence of a woman who, despite her wealth and influence, faced significant judgment and scandal.

The Story of Rebekah Harkness



To fully appreciate the depth of Swift's lyrics, it is essential to understand who Rebekah Harkness was:

1. Background: Rebekah Harkness was born in 1915 into a well-to-do family. She became a prominent figure in New York City’s social scene during the mid-20th century.
2. Marriage to Bill Harkness: In 1947, she married oil magnate Bill Harkness, which significantly increased her social standing. The couple was known for their lavish lifestyle.
3. Cultural Impact: Rebekah was not just a socialite; she was also involved in various charitable activities, including the founding of the Harkness Ballet, which contributed to her legacy.

Through the lens of Swift's song, Harkness's life is depicted as both glamorous and fraught with controversy, illustrating how societal expectations can shape a woman's narrative.

Legacy and Reputation



One of the song's central themes is the idea of legacy. Swift examines how women’s legacies are often overshadowed by scandal, regardless of their accomplishments.

- Judgment and Misunderstanding: Harkness faced scrutiny for her lifestyle choices and was often criticized for her extravagant spending and social engagements. Swift's lyrics highlight how society tends to focus on the negative aspects of a woman's life, rather than her achievements.
- Redefining Legacy: By telling Harkness’s story, Swift aims to redefine her legacy as one of empowerment rather than scandal. The line, “There goes the last great American dynasty,” suggests a shift in how we view influential women in history.

Feminism and Societal Expectations



The song also serves as a commentary on feminism and the societal expectations placed upon women.

- Breaking Stereotypes: Rebekah Harkness defied the conventional roles of women in her time. She was not just a wife but an active participant in the arts and philanthropy. The narrative challenges listeners to reconsider the roles women play in shaping culture and history.
- Critique of Patriarchy: Swift subtly critiques the patriarchal society that often diminishes women's contributions. By elevating Harkness's story, Swift encourages a reevaluation of women's histories.
